Elemental Powers Tycoon is a Roblox game that mashes two things kids love together: tycoon base-building and elemental powers. You build up your own base, unlock elemental abilities like fire, ice, and lightning, and use them to dominate other players. It sounds like a lot, and honestly, it kind of is.
How the Game Actually Works
You start with a basic tycoon plot and drop cash to unlock new parts of your base. The usual stuff. But the twist here is that as your tycoon grows, you unlock elemental powers that give you combat abilities on the map. Fire lets you blast other players, ice can slow enemies down, and different elements have their own unique feel.
The grind loop is pretty simple. Collect money from your base, spend it on upgrades, unlock stronger powers, repeat. There are different elements to work toward, so there’s always something to aim for. PvP is also part of the mix, so you can raid other players or defend your own base from attacks.
It plays like a classic Roblox tycoon on the surface, but the elemental combat layer gives it more personality than most. Picking your element and building around it actually matters, which makes the choices feel a little more meaningful than just clicking buttons for numbers.
What’s Fun, What’s Not
The elemental powers are genuinely cool. Getting a full fire or lightning build going feels satisfying, and the combat is fun when the servers are active. If you find a good server with a bunch of players all fighting each other, it gets chaotic in the best way.
The frustrating part is the grind. Early game is slow. Like, really slow. Sitting there waiting for your tycoon to generate enough cash to unlock the next upgrade gets boring fast, especially when you can see other players already stomping around with maxed-out powers. The pay-to-win angle is real here too, with gamepasses that speed things up significantly.
The player count has dropped since the game’s peak, so finding a full, active server isn’t always guaranteed. It’s not dead, but it’s not popping off either. If you get lucky with a busy server it’s a great time, but quiet servers kill the vibe pretty fast since PvP is such a big part of the appeal.
